7. Circumvention
Circumvention, when thought-about inside the realm of strategies to transmit SMS communications from a supply distinct from the precise sender’s, describes actions taken to bypass commonplace identification or safety protocols. It represents efforts to keep away from typical verification processes or restrictions that may usually stop the alteration of the displayed originating quantity.
-
Exploiting Protocol Weaknesses
Circumvention regularly includes exploiting weaknesses in SMS protocols or telecommunications community configurations. This may embrace manipulating header fields, using unpatched vulnerabilities in routing methods, or leveraging misconfigured infrastructure to route messages by means of unintended paths. An instance is gaining unauthorized entry to an SMS gateway server and modifying the supply deal with of messages despatched by means of that gateway. The implications are that safety vulnerabilities will be exploited for malicious functions, reminiscent of phishing assaults or spreading misinformation, whereas masking the true origin of the communication.
-
Leveraging Third-Get together Companies with Lax Safety
One other type of circumvention entails utilizing third-party SMS providers or platforms that possess insufficient safety measures or verification processes. These providers might not totally validate the claimed originating quantity or might enable customers to specify arbitrary sender IDs. That is particularly frequent with smaller, unregulated providers working throughout worldwide borders. The consequence is that malicious actors can simply make the most of these providers to ship SMS messages with spoofed sender IDs, making it troublesome to hint the true origin of the communication and rising the chance of fraud.
-
Bypassing Service Restrictions
Some cell community operators implement restrictions on the power to change sender IDs or originate SMS messages from sure forms of numbers. Circumvention can contain using strategies to bypass these restrictions, reminiscent of utilizing specialised software program or {hardware} that modifies the message header earlier than it’s transmitted to the community. An actual-world instance consists of using SIM bins with modified firmware to spoof sender IDs and evade provider laws. The implications are a weakening of safety measures supposed to guard shoppers from fraud and spam, and a better problem for legislation enforcement companies trying to research unlawful SMS communications.
-
Using Gray Routes and SIM Farms
Gray routes confer with unofficial or unauthorized pathways for transmitting SMS messages, usually involving the exploitation of pricing discrepancies between totally different networks. SIM farms are collections of SIM playing cards used to ship and obtain SMS messages in bulk, usually employed to bypass restrictions on messaging volumes or to masks the true origin of messages. By routing messages by means of these channels, senders can keep away from commonplace safety protocols and circumvent restrictions on sender ID modification. The impact is lowering transparency and accountability in SMS communications, and enhancing the power of malicious actors to conduct actions reminiscent of spamming and phishing with out detection.
